High vitamin D levels linked to lower risk of colon cancer

Friday, January 22, 2010 - 01:21 in Health & Medicine

High blood levels of vitamin D are associated with a lower risk of colon cancer, finds a large European study. The risk was cut by as much as 40 percent in people with the highest levels compared with those in the lowest.
